Here are some key points on twentieth century literature, with a particular emphasis on modernism.

Modernism was an age in the arts that took place from the late 19th century until the middle of the 20th century. Its impact on literature can plainly still be felt today. So, exactly what was modernism? Essentially, it was a method to art that emphasises development. Modernism can be viewed as a phenomenon of breaking away from conventional approaches to art. For instance, cubism radically reinterpreted technique to perspective. In literature, authors looked to reinterpret fiction, poetry and drama. Authors wanted to reorganize the novel; originalities on narrative sequencing, for example, provided fiction a more fragmented aesthetic that seemed to run parallel to the moving sands of early twentieth century modernity. Contemporary concepts in psychology and physics likewise informed how modernists authors approached the novel. Film, a new medium for the 20th century, likewise influenced how poets and authors approached their work. An era of creative manifestos, the concepts of Dada, futurism and surrealism showed particularly impactful during the 1920s. The concepts of Expressionism, inspired by both meaning and Impressionism, also found its method into literature. Languages and dialects were also synthesised in prominent works of poetry and fiction of this time. Indeed, this sense of innovation can be felt throughout much of the best books to read from modernism; it can be viewed as a creative era that emphasised experimentalism, with a spirit of 'making it new'. An interesting dynamic to explore throughout twentieth century art is the relationship in between film and literature. Both had mutual influence on each other. For example, noir literature, with its origins in fin de siècle detective books, gave rise to film noir. Undoubtedly, film noir became a stimuli for numerous other film categories, which in turn influenced by the advancement of literary fiction. Historical fiction, on the other hand, has actually likewise shown extremely motivating for film directors. Indeed, this literary genre has a rich capacity for immersing reading into historical epoch, with some of the best novels to read from this genre also proving scholarly informative.
